Sizemore sentenced to jail, probation
Oregon anti-tax activist Bill Sizemore was sentenced to 30 days in jail and three years probation after pleading guilty Thursday to three counts of Oregon personal income tax evasion, a class C felony. As the Portland Business Journal reports, Sizemore was Oregon’s Republican nominee for governor in 1998, but lost to Democrat John Kitzhaber.
